Hooker's Finest Fruits; A Selection of Paintings of Fruits by William Hooker (1779-1832) New York Prentice-Hall Press 1989 First Edition Thus Hard Cover Fine Very Good Lovely condition with only one small tear and wrinkle to lower front corner and a bit of sunning to just the top front edge caused by book being taller than the one next to it on the shelf and facing the window. Otherwise it's clean as a whistle inside and out with no names or writing and pristine pages and page edges.It's a large book measuring 9"x12-1/4", has not been price-clipped, and is very attractive in a brand new mylar cover.Hooker was, and is, one of the finest botanical illustrators, but he was also an artist who gardened, so his love of plants extended beyond visual appreciation. The paintings, those here being a portion of the total, were commissioned by the Horticultural Society of London and consisted of a wide array of fruit types, all of which are meticulously described. Book includes 96 color plates and is very beautiful. Price:
